Frequently Asked Questions
What is clinical trial NCT01325142 about?
NCT01325142 is a clinical study titled "Genetic Risk of Osteonecrosis of the Jaw (ONJ) in Patients With Metastatic Cancer". This study seeks to identify risk factors associated with the development of a jaw condition seen in patients with cancer treated with certain medications.
What is the current status of trial NCT01325142?
This trial is currently completed. The enrollment target is 271 participants. The study started on 2010-08. Estimated completion is 2014-11.
What conditions does trial NCT01325142 study?
This clinical trial studies the following conditions: Osteonecrosis, Metastases, Bone Diseases, Bisphosphonate-Associated Osteonecrosis of the Jaw.
